Incorporating Drone Photography into Wedding Shoots

drone photography into wedding shoots

Weddings are moments of emotion, beauty, and unforgettable experiences, and capturing them effectively requires creativity and adaptability. Traditional photography and videography capture the details up close, but incorporating drone photography opens a new perspective that enhances the storytelling of a wedding day. With drones, photographers can capture expansive outdoor scenes, unique angles, and cinematic movements that are impossible from the ground. We will explore how drone photography can transform wedding shoots, offering couples a fresh way to preserve memories and photographers an opportunity to elevate their portfolio with dynamic imagery. The use of drones introduces a combination of aerial artistry and technical skill, allowing every wedding to be seen from breathtaking viewpoints that bring the overall celebration to life.

Enhancing Wedding Photography with Drones

Expanding Creative Perspectives

Drone photography allows photographers, including a Las Vegas wedding photographer, to capture wide, sweeping views of wedding venues, surroundings, and gatherings that ground-based cameras cannot achieve. These aerial shots are especially valuable in outdoor weddings set in scenic locations such as beaches, gardens, or mountains. By flying above the scene, photographers can create compositions that frame the couple, guests, and environment in visually compelling ways. Drones provide the flexibility to experiment with height, angles, and movement, resulting in unique visuals for albums and highlight reels. For example, capturing the couple walking down a tree-lined path from above adds a narrative quality that feels cinematic and expansive. This perspective helps document the scale and ambiance of the wedding, complementing close-up portraits and detailed shots taken on the ground. Drone imagery can make ordinary locations appear extraordinary, turning familiar venues into striking visual landscapes.

Capturing Dynamic Movement

Traditional photography often limits the way motion is portrayed, but drones allow for dynamic shots that follow action and create immersive storytelling. Aerial shots of the couple entering the ceremony, guests arriving, or the first dance from above can reveal patterns, energy, and emotions that might otherwise be missed. Drone operators can track movement smoothly, producing sweeping videos that feel fluid and dramatic. This capability is particularly useful for capturing processions, outdoor activities, or even coordinated group formations. In addition, drones can create reveal shots, gradually unveiling a scene or moment in a way that adds suspense and elegance. By incorporating movement, aerial imagery can highlight the rhythm of the wedding day, making the final photos and videos more engaging, cinematic, and memorable. Drone photography enhances the narrative flow of a wedding, allowing the story to unfold naturally and dynamically.

Integrating with Traditional Photography

While drones provide aerial perspectives, integrating these shots with traditional photography ensures a cohesive visual story. Photographers can plan sequences that combine close-ups, mid-range shots, and aerial views to create albums and highlight reels with depth and variety. For example, a ceremony may be photographed with intimate portraits and candid interactions on the ground, while drones capture the venue layout, guest arrangements, and natural surroundings from above. This combination enhances storytelling, providing multiple layers of perspective for couples to relive the day. Drones also offer a creative bridge between still photography and videography, giving editors footage that can be used for dynamic slideshows, cinematic cuts, or social media content. The integration requires careful coordination to avoid interference, maintain safety, and ensure that drone movements complement rather than distract from the main events. The result is a well-rounded collection of images that balances detail, scale, and motion.

Overcoming Challenges and Considerations

Incorporating drones into wedding photography requires attention to technical, logistical, and regulatory factors. Operators must consider weather conditions, battery life, and signal reliability to ensure uninterrupted shooting. Drones can be affected by wind, rain, or limited visibility, which may constrain certain shots. Additionally, photographers must comply with local aviation rules and restrictions, particularly in urban areas or public spaces. Safety is paramount, especially when flying above guests or near structures, so proper planning and risk assessment are essential. Effective communication with the couple, wedding planner, and venue staff helps manage expectations and minimize potential disruptions. By addressing these considerations, drone photography can be safely integrated into wedding shoots while still capturing the desired creative angles. Understanding the capabilities and limitations of the equipment allows photographers to maximize the impact of aerial imagery without compromising quality or safety.

Elevating Emotional Impact

Drone photography enhances the emotional resonance of wedding coverage by presenting moments in ways that evoke awe and perspective. Aerial shots can show the scale of a celebration, the connection between guests, and the beauty of the setting, amplifying the emotional significance of each event. Couples often respond positively to images that capture them in context, surrounded by friends, family, and scenic beauty, creating a sense of intimacy despite the broad viewpoint. Drone shots can also highlight symbolic elements, such as the unity of a ceremony, the excitement of celebrations, or the quiet moments shared privately. This emotional dimension adds depth to the final collection, ensuring that the images are not only visually striking but also meaningful. By providing a new perspective, drone photography transforms conventional wedding documentation into an artful representation of love, connection, and celebration.

Incorporating drone photography into wedding shoots introduces a transformative approach to capturing special moments. Aerial perspectives, dynamic movement, and expanded creative possibilities allow photographers to document weddings in ways that are immersive and visually engaging. By integrating drone shots with traditional photography, addressing technical considerations, and emphasizing storytelling, couples receive a comprehensive record of their day that is both cinematic and emotionally resonant. Drone photography offers a fresh perspective that elevates wedding coverage, creating images that highlight scale, motion, and ambiance. The result is a portfolio of memories that couples can cherish, reflecting the uniqueness and beauty of their celebration from viewpoints that were once inaccessible.
